Publisher Summary Biotin l -sulfoxide occurs in the culture filtrates of various microorganisms. It has been prepared by the oxidation of biotin with 1 mole of hydrogen peroxide and by fractional crystallization of the resulting mixture of biotin d -sulfoxide and biotin l -sulfoxide. It can be prepared more conveniently and in better yield by the oxidation of biotin with 1 mole of hydrogen peroxide and treatment of the resulting mixture of sulfoxides with 1 N hydrochloric acid. This method is described in the chapter in detail.
